"Microsoft also plans to release Project Quant 
<http://www.securosis.com/projectquant>, an online information resource 
that aims to provide organizations with a framework for evaluating the 
cost of patch management processes. According to a survey conduct as 
part of the project, nearly 50% of respondents had no patch 
<http://www.techweb.com/encyclopedia/defineterm.jhtml?term=patch&x=&y=> 
management process for desktop application software 
<http://www.techweb.com/encyclopedia/defineterm.jhtml?term=application%20software&x=&y=> \
 or had an informal process."
